The Pelham/Amherst area is rich with culture. There are five high quality Colleges in the area, and each offers many opportunities to see and do things. For example, The Museum of Art and the Botanical Gardens at Smith College. Other local attractions include The Eric Carle Museum, Museum at the Home of Emily Dickinson, The Magic Wings Butterfly Conservatory, Historic Deerfield and much more. Also, within a short drive there are Rhode Island and Connecticut ocean beaches and scenic Cape Cod for the summertime, the Berkshires and several Vermont and New Hampshire mountains for skiing and wintertime fun. There are many year-round hiking and nature trails, most of which are dog friendly. The Connecticut River offers 2 local marinas, canoeing and white-water rafting.
